Take away the tick fastidiously
Extricating a tick that’s determined to make a meal of you or your children isn’t simple — they get in there — and also you wish to make sure that to get the entire factor out as quickly as potential. Per the CDC…
Grasp the tick as near the pores and skin’s floor as potential utilizing clear fine-tipped tweezers. If fine-tipped tweezers usually are not accessible, use common tweezers or your fingers to know the tick. Grasp the tick near the pores and skin’s floor to keep away from squeezing the tick’s physique.
Pull the tick away from the pores and skin with regular, even strain. Do not twist or jerk the tick. This may trigger the tick mouthparts to interrupt off and stay within the pores and skin. If this occurs, your physique will naturally push the mouthparts out over time as your pores and skin heals. You too can take away the mouthparts with tweezers. In case you can’t take away the mouthparts simply with tweezers, go away them alone.
After eradicating the tick, totally clear the chunk space and your fingers with cleaning soap and water, rubbing alcohol, or hand sanitizer.

The CDC recommends disposing of the (dwell) tick by putting it in a sealed container (extra on this in a second), wrapping it tightly in tape and throwing it within the rubbish; flushing it down the bathroom; or placing it in alcohol. Don’t crush it together with your fingers.
Comply with-up if obligatory
Whereas there are labs that purport to check discarded ticks for diseases, the CDC doesn’t advocate this as industrial labs usually are not held to rigorous requirements and doubtful take a look at outcomes can both result in a false sense of safety or panic (a tick with Lyme illness doesn’t essentially imply you have Lyme illness).
Nonetheless, it may be helpful to deliver the tick in a plastic baggie to the physician, who will seemingly be higher capable of establish what sort of tick has bitten you or your beloved.
Talking of docs, you need to observe up with one for those who develop a rash or fever inside a number of weeks of eradicating a tick. Inform the physician in regards to the chunk and when (and if potential, the place) it occurred.
